RUSSIA: ‘UN Syria investigator quits over concern about Russian obstruction’, Guardian, 6 August 2017
Obstructions placed in the way of Syrian war crimes prosecutions by the United Nations and Russia contributed to the decision of Carla Del Ponte, a renowned war crimes prosecutor, to resign as one of three members of a UN commission of inquiry. Del Ponte quit as a member of the UN commission of inquiry on Syria because her role had come to be an alibi for inaction.
